Real Madrid and Lenovo Tenerife go head to head once again in the Copa del Rey semi-finals in a repeat match of last season’s clash, which saw our side run out 85-79 winners. This evening both sides meet at Granada’s Palacio de los Deportes 6:30pm CET and Pablo Laso’s charges will be looking to replicate last campaign’s cup win and reach the final for the ninth time in a row.

The Whites are fully aware of what is required to defeat Vidorreta’s side, as last year’s semi-final win will be fresh in their minds. However, having beaten Joventut in the quarter-finals, the Canary islanders booked their place in the semi-finals for the fourth time in the last five years 2018, 2019, 2021 and 2022 and will give Madrid a stern test. They have also had a consistent league season, which has seen the side pick up 11 wins from 19 matches.
This evening´s matchup will come down to the fine margins, and two of these aspects will be the pace of play and the defence, according to Pablo Laso. The madridistas produced a sublime defensively display against Breogán, with Tavares and Abalde, the standout performers in this area. At the other end, Madrid will have to be as clinical in attack as they were in the quarter-finals, when four players recording double-digit scoring in points and PIR Yabusele, Tavares, Abalde and Heurtel.

Lenovo Tenerife
Real Madrid’s opponents go into the Copa del Rey semi-final clash after edging past Joventut 62-64, spearheaded by Shermadini, who racked up 12 points, 8 rebounds and a PIR of 18. The Whites will also have to do their best to stop Tenerife’s long-distance shooters, as the likes of Wiltjer over 50% success rate in three-pointers in the league and Doornekamp pose a real threat. This will be another stern test for Madrid, who go in search of a win to book a place in tomorrow's final.
